World's Best Green Tea The most famous green tea in China is certainly Long Jing, which is grown in the mountains around the West Lake area of Hangzhou.
According to many tea experts, the Longjing tea is amongst the finest and most representative of green teas.
It has been described as the "ideal" beverage for "quiet, contemplative times."
This tea has a very distinctive shape: smooth and perfectly flattened along the inside vein of the leaf, the result of highly skilled shaping in a hot wok. Natural sweetness from the jade green leaf establishes a complex palette in this renowed sweet nutty tea.
The tea contains Vitamin C, amino acids, and, like most finer Chinese green teas, has one of the highest concentrations of catechins among teas.
Quality: Special Grade Weight: 50 grams Harvest Time: Ming Qian/Pre-Qingming (Before Ching Ming) Taste: The pleasant aroma is refreshingly light; lightly sweet with a smooth texture and hint of lingering chestnut. A truly satisfying cup of tea.
Preparation: Use 3g tea per 150ml of water. Heat water to 80-85℃ and steep for 1-3 minutes. For stronger flavor, use more. Brewing vessel: Glass or porcelain pot Infusions: At least 3 times Shelf Life: 18 months Origin: West Lake, Hangzhou
